在软件开发的旅程中,测试阶段往往是一个关键环节。一个高效的测试方案能够帮助团队发现并解决潜在的问题,确保项目质量,同时还能节省时间和资源。以下五大实用步骤,将帮助你制定一个能够助力项目顺利推进的高效测试方案。
1. 确定测试目标与范围
主题句:明确的目标是制定高效测试方案的第一步。
在进行测试之前,你需要清晰地定义测试目标。这包括确定要测试的功能、性能指标、安全性要求等。同时,合理划分测试范围,确保覆盖所有重要的功能模块,避免遗漏。
- 步骤:
- 与项目团队成员沟通,明确项目需求和预期目标。
- 根据需求文档和用户故事,制定详细的测试目标。
- 划分测试范围,包括功能测试、性能测试、安全性测试等。
2. 制定测试计划
主题句:一个周密的测试计划是确保测试活动有序进行的基石。
测试计划应详细说明测试活动的各个阶段、资源分配、时间表和风险评估。
- 步骤:
- 制定详细的测试计划,包括测试方法、测试用例、测试工具和测试环境。
- 确定测试团队的组成和角色分配。
- 设定关键里程碑和交付物,确保项目按时完成。
3. 设计和编写测试用例
主题句:精良的测试用例是测试活动的灵魂。
测试用例应该全面、系统,能够覆盖所有测试场景和边界条件。编写测试用例时,要考虑易读性、可维护性和可重复性。
- 步骤:
- 分析需求,设计测试用例的输入和输出。
- 确定测试用例的优先级和执行顺序。
- 使用测试管理工具记录和跟踪测试用例。
4. 执行测试与问题跟踪
主题句:高效的测试执行和问题跟踪是保证项目质量的关键。
在执行测试时,要严格按照测试用例进行操作,同时要注重发现问题的及时记录和跟踪。
- 步骤:
- 根据测试计划执行测试,确保覆盖所有测试用例。
- 使用缺陷跟踪工具记录发现的缺陷,包括缺陷描述、严重性和优先级。
- 与开发团队紧密合作,推动缺陷的修复。
5. 测试结果分析与报告
主题句:详尽的测试报告能够为项目决策提供有力支持。
测试结束后,要对测试结果进行分析,总结经验教训,形成测试报告,为项目决策提供依据。
- 步骤:
- 分析测试数据,评估项目质量。
- 总结测试过程中的问题和不足,提出改进建议。
- 撰写测试报告,包括测试总结、缺陷统计和改进建议。
通过以上五大步骤,你将能够制定出一个高效且实用的测试方案,助力项目顺利推进。记住,测试不仅仅是发现缺陷,更是一种对项目质量负责的态度。
